Key Features Comparison

Silex
Silex Features
  • Built on Symfony components
  • Lightweight and fast
  • Easy routing
  • Templating with Twig
  • Service providers
  • Middleware support
  • PSR-7 compatible
  • Supports PHP 5.5 and up
